To those with visual impairments, disorders, dyslexia, etc when reading fanfic, what issues do you face? by OmnipotentShipper in FanFiction

[–]talonsinning 2 points3 points  (0 children)

I use a screen reader to read due to disability reasons, and usually it's pretty good but any kind of emoji in the text really throws me off. I read a fic that used them as breaks between sections and my screen reader would read out a bunch of emoji names every time

When I write I use 3 dashes as section breaks as my screen reader doesn't read those out
